Research Analysts Offer Predictions for AGIO Q1 Earnings

Agios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:AGIOFree Report) – HC Wainwright lifted their Q1 2026 EPS estimates for shares of Agios Pharmaceuticals in a report issued on Thursday, February 12th. HC Wainwright analyst E. Bodnar now expects that the biopharmaceutical company will post earnings of ($1.82) per share for the quarter, up from their prior estimate of ($1.86). HC Wainwright currently has a “Buy” rating and a $65.00 target price on the stock. The consensus estimate for Agios Pharmaceuticals’ current full-year earnings is ($6.85) per share. HC Wainwright also issued estimates for Agios Pharmaceuticals’ Q2 2026 earnings at ($1.66) EPS, Q3 2026 earnings at ($1.63) EPS, Q4 2026 earnings at ($1.58) EPS, FY2026 earnings at ($6.68) EPS, FY2027 earnings at ($5.48) EPS, FY2028 earnings at ($4.24) EPS and FY2029 earnings at ($2.49) EPS.

AGIO has been the subject of a number of other research reports. Zacks Research upgraded Agios Pharmaceuticals from a “strong s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Tuesday, November 4th. Weiss Ratings reiterated a “sell (d)” rating on shares of Agios Pharmaceuticals in a report on Monday, December 29th. Wall Street Zen upgraded shares of Agios Pharmaceuticals from a “s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Saturday. Bank of America increased their price target on shares of Agios Pharmaceuticals from $32.00 to $34.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research note on Wednesday, December 24th. Finally, The Goldman Sachs Group lowered their price target on shares of Agios Pharmaceuticals from $40.00 to $25.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a research report on Thursday, November 20th. Six research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, four have issued a Hold rating and one has issued a Sell r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the company presently has an average rating of “Hold” and an average price target of $39.78.

Agios Pharmaceuticals Price Performance

Shares of AGIO opened at $27.96 on Monday. The company has a 50-day simple moving average of $27.41 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$33.95. The firm has a market capitalization of $1.64 billion, a PE ratio of -3.93 and a beta of 0.91. Agios Pharmaceuticals has a one year low of $22.24 and a one year high of $46.00.

Insider Transactions at Agios Pharmaceuticals

In other news, insider Tsveta Milanova sold 2,932 shares of the st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, December 30th. The shares were sold at an average price of $27.09, for a total transaction of $79,427.88. Following the sale, the insider owned 29,190 shares in the company, valued at $790,757.10. This represents a 9.13%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available through the SEC website. Also, CEO Brian Goff sold 18,703 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, December 30th. The stock was sold at an average price of $27.09, for a total transaction of $506,664.27.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er owned 136,583 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$3,700,033.47. The trade was a 12.04%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The disclosure for this sale is available in the SEC filing. In the last quarter, insiders have sold 33,303 shares of company stock valued at $901,977. 4.93% of the stock is currently owned by insiders.

Agios Pharmaceuticals Company Profile

Agios Pharmaceuticals, Inc is a biopharmaceutical company founded in 2008 as a spin-out from research at Dana-Farber Cancer Institute and the Broad Institute. Headquartered in Cambridge, Massachusetts, Agios focuses on understanding and targeting cellular metabolism to develop novel therapies for cancer and rare genetic diseases. The company’s scientific platform integrates genomic discovery, metabolic profiling and precision medicine approaches to identify and advance small-molecule candidates that correct or exploit metabolic dysfunction.

Agios’s lead products are IDH (isocitrate dehydrogenase) inhibitors that target specific cancer mutations.
